Transaction dc6afc4b5bf3071f4f791581d26792ffd53fcf53454d10efd7776ac1809be21a
1 Input
1 Output
-
dc6afc4b5bf3071f4f791581d26792ffd53fcf53454d10efd7776ac1809be21a:0
- value
- 62602200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b2a370047e93c6fbda9b631d94dcc277d833490 OP_EQUAL
- address
- 32i3vnwjz3SHnfXrsmcpxjaRyPhfd87rCN